Cogs.Core
litehtml::document Member List

This is the complete list of members for litehtml::document, including all inherited members.

add_fixed_box(const position &pos) (defined in litehtml::document)litehtml::document
add_font(const tchar_t *name, int size, const tchar_t *weight, const tchar_t *style, const tchar_t *decoration, font_metrics *fm) (defined in litehtml::document)litehtml::documentprivate
add_media_list(media_query_list::ptr list) (defined in litehtml::document)litehtml::document
add_stylesheet(const tchar_t *str, const tchar_t *baseurl, const tchar_t *media) (defined in litehtml::document)litehtml::document
add_tabular(const element::ptr &el) (defined in litehtml::document)litehtml::documentinline
apply_styles(const litehtml::css *styles) (defined in litehtml::document)litehtml::document
container() (defined in litehtml::document)litehtml::documentinline
create_element(const tchar_t *tag_name, const string_map &attributes) (defined in litehtml::document)litehtml::document
create_node(void *gnode, elements_vector &elements, bool parseTextNode, document::ptr doc) (defined in litehtml::document)litehtml::documentstatic
createFromString(const tchar_t *str, litehtml::document_container *objPainter, litehtml::context *ctx, litehtml::css *user_styles=0) (defined in litehtml::document)litehtml::documentstatic
createFromUTF8(const char *str, litehtml::document_container *objPainter, litehtml::context *ctx, litehtml::css *user_styles=0) (defined in litehtml::document)litehtml::documentstatic
cvt_units(const tchar_t *str, int fontSize, bool *is_percent=0) const (defined in litehtml::document)litehtml::document
cvt_units(css_length &val, int fontSize, int size=0) const (defined in litehtml::document)litehtml::document
document(litehtml::document_container *objContainer, litehtml::context *ctx) (defined in litehtml::document)litehtml::document
draw(uint_ptr hdc, int x, int y, const position *clip) (defined in litehtml::document)litehtml::document
fix_table_children(element::ptr &el_ptr, style_display disp, const tchar_t *disp_str) (defined in litehtml::document)litehtml::documentprivate
fix_table_parent(element::ptr &el_ptr, style_display disp, const tchar_t *disp_str) (defined in litehtml::document)litehtml::documentprivate
fix_tables_layout() (defined in litehtml::document)litehtml::documentprivate
get_context() const (defined in litehtml::document)litehtml::documentinline
get_def_color() (defined in litehtml::document)litehtml::documentinline
get_fixed_boxes(position::vector &fixed_boxes) (defined in litehtml::document)litehtml::document
get_font(const tchar_t *name, int size, const tchar_t *weight, const tchar_t *style, const tchar_t *decoration, font_metrics *fm) (defined in litehtml::document)litehtml::document
get_styles() const (defined in litehtml::document)litehtml::documentinline
get_userdata() (defined in litehtml::document)litehtml::documentinline
height() const (defined in litehtml::document)litehtml::document
is_initialised() const (defined in litehtml::document)litehtml::documentinline
lang_changed() (defined in litehtml::document)litehtml::document
m_container (defined in litehtml::document)litehtml::documentprivate
m_context (defined in litehtml::document)litehtml::documentprivate
m_css (defined in litehtml::document)litehtml::documentprivate
m_culture (defined in litehtml::document)litehtml::documentprivate
m_def_color (defined in litehtml::document)litehtml::documentprivate
m_fixed_boxes (defined in litehtml::document)litehtml::documentprivate
m_fonts (defined in litehtml::document)litehtml::documentprivate
m_initialised (defined in litehtml::document)litehtml::documentprivate
m_lang (defined in litehtml::document)litehtml::documentprivate
m_media (defined in litehtml::document)litehtml::documentprivate
m_media_lists (defined in litehtml::document)litehtml::documentprivate
m_over_element (defined in litehtml::document)litehtml::documentprivate
m_root (defined in litehtml::document)litehtml::documentprivate
m_size (defined in litehtml::document)litehtml::documentprivate
m_styles (defined in litehtml::document)litehtml::documentprivate
m_tabular_elements (defined in litehtml::document)litehtml::documentprivate
m_userdata (defined in litehtml::document)litehtml::documentprivate
match_lang(const tstring &lang) (defined in litehtml::document)litehtml::documentinline
media_changed() (defined in litehtml::document)litehtml::document
on_lbutton_down(int x, int y, int client_x, int client_y, position::vector &redraw_boxes) (defined in litehtml::document)litehtml::document
on_lbutton_up(int x, int y, int client_x, int client_y, position::vector &redraw_boxes) (defined in litehtml::document)litehtml::document
on_mouse_leave(position::vector &redraw_boxes) (defined in litehtml::document)litehtml::document
on_mouse_move(int x, int y) (defined in litehtml::document)litehtml::document
on_mouse_over(int x, int y, int client_x, int client_y, position::vector &redraw_boxes) (defined in litehtml::document)litehtml::document
ptr typedef (defined in litehtml::document)litehtml::document
render(int max_width, render_type rt=render_all) (defined in litehtml::document)litehtml::document
root() (defined in litehtml::document)litehtml::documentinline
set_userdata(void *userdata) (defined in litehtml::document)litehtml::documentinline
update_media_lists(const media_features &features) (defined in litehtml::document)litehtml::documentprivate
weak_ptr typedef (defined in litehtml::document)litehtml::document
width() const (defined in litehtml::document)litehtml::document
~document() (defined in litehtml::document)litehtml::documentvirtual